ANOTHER RAID?

ON GERMAN NAVAL PORTS GNEISENAU REPORTED SUNK. .FRENCH RAID ON FRANKFORT. By Telegraph—Press Association—Copyright. (Received This Day, 11.30 a.m.) BASLE, September 6. A radio broadcast heard here said the German pocket battleship Gneisenau was sunk by British raiding planes in the Wilhelmshaven attack. It also said that French planes had raided Frankfort on Main. It is not disclosed whether the broadcast referred to Monday’s Wilhelmshaven raid or to a new one.
